
Qashqai headlight assembly removal method is as follows: 1. Open the hood, there is an iron hook on the inner side of both headlights. At the back of the headlight, there is a plastic screw used to lock the headlight. Unscrew the two plastic screws at the back of the headlight, then pull the iron hook outward to the end, and the headlight can be taken out. 2. The headlight wiring harness is fixed by a snap-fit. Feel below the connector with your hand to find the buckle, press it down to release the wiring harness. 3. After removing the headlight, you can observe the headlight base and its fixing method. The central fixing rail is used to slide the headlight in or out, the iron hook on the right is the locking device, pulling it out will release the headlight, pushing it in will lock the headlight. After unplugging the wiring harness, the headlight assembly can be removed.

To remove the Qashqai headlight assembly, I've tried several times, mainly focusing on the sequence of steps and tool preparation. First, ensure safety by opening the engine hood and disconnecting the negative battery terminal with a 10mm wrench or socket to avoid electric shock risks. Next, clear any debris around the engine compartment. Locate the plastic trim panels around the headlight assembly—some are inside the wheel arch liners—and gently pry open the clips with a plastic pry tool, being careful not to break them. The screws are usually located above or on the side of the assembly; use a Phillips screwdriver to remove them, and remember to note how many there are. For the electrical connectors, press the small clips to release them before pulling, avoiding any forceful tugging to prevent damage. Then, support the assembly with both hands and slowly pull it out, being careful not to damage other parts of the vehicle. After completion, inspect all components for integrity. The process takes about half an hour, and beginners are advised to wear gloves to prevent scratches.
